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

South Pointe Christian School is situated along Highway 9 in the rural outskirts of Pageland, South Carolina, a region known for its quiet charm and agricultural roots. The venue is easily accessible via the main regional thoroughfares that connect rural Chesterfield County to neighboring towns. Visitors typically arrive by private vehicle, as public transit options in this area are extremely limited or nonexistent. Charlotte Douglas International Airport (CLT) is the primary gateway for those traveling from out of state, usually requiring a drive of approximately 60 to 75 minutes. Because the venue is located outside the dense city center, parking is generally handled on-site within school-designated areas.

Navigating to the school is straightforward, but visitors should prepare for typical rural highway traffic patterns that can fluctuate during school start and end times. Rideshare services are not as readily available in Pageland as they are in major metropolitan areas, so coordinating personal transportation is strongly advised for all attendees. When arriving for major events, it is best to follow the signage provided by school staff to ensure you are directed to the correct parking zones. Planning your route in advance and allowing extra time for potential slow-moving agricultural traffic on local roads will help ensure a stress-free arrival process for your group.

Section 07

Local Tips

Highway 9 traffic: Traffic on Highway 9 can slow down significantly during school arrival and dismissal times on weekdays.

Plan for rural driving: Roads in this area are primarily two-lane, so allow extra travel time between your hotel and venue.

Pack your own shade: Outdoor event viewing areas may lack shade, so bring portable chairs and umbrellas for your group's comfort.

Cash is king: Some smaller local businesses in the area may prefer cash transactions, so keep some on hand for convenience.

Check the schedule: Always verify event times with your team coordinator as schedules can shift based on tournament bracket updates.

Seasonal note: Pageland experiences distinct seasonal shifts, with hot and humid summers being the busiest time for outdoor sports and community events. Spring and fall offer the most pleasant weather for travel, featuring mild temperatures that make walking and outdoor activities much more comfortable. Winter is generally quiet, though visitors should be prepared for occasional chilly mornings. Regardless of the season, the pace of life remains relaxed, and visitors will find the local community welcoming throughout the year.
